Hackers got 170 million identity documents that they're selling on the dark web. And the scans were reported by a cybersecurity expert and linked to a new identity theft service. and the service was discovered after it was advertised on a Russian cybercrime forum.

Wow.

So they said they have 153 million scans of driver's licenses from the US and Canada, an additional 10 million ID cards, 3 million travel documents, international IDs, and then of course a bunch of medical IDs. And apparently, some were able to gain access to the service, and they said that an undetermined number of other forms of identification are also on the site. Wow.

You can't, I mean, you can't even ride a horse. People get DOIs on horses, which that I don't understand because the horse has its own mind. You know what I'm saying? It can do what it wants. Icelanders vote no to talks aimed at joining the EU.

That's actually smart. They shouldn't join the EU because it's trash. The little bitty Nordic nation, they've decided against resuming talks about the country joining the European Union in a closely contested referendum. The vote against the EU was over 52%. That's pretty significant.

This is not the first time that they've considered and rejected it. It also happened again back in 2013, right after a banking collapse from a global economic crisis. But people didn't want to lose sovereign control over their fisheries. That's the nation's largest export, so it didn't go. Coming up.
